Output ed40debfce6805829556fc20f327ac310f578dfa0126bfe3b22f31fe6f284901:15

value
3583
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 fb63eeed589f606e62fd39d96f85ec0aafa71b21364cf320846836bff8d5b767
address
bc1pld37am2cnasxucha88vklp0vp2h6wxepxex0xgyydqmtl7x4kansnkeffe
transaction
ed40debfce6805829556fc20f327ac310f578dfa0126bfe3b22f31fe6f284901
spent
true